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Eastern Squeaker | Lesser Egyptian Gerbil |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om same | Animalia (Animals) | Animalia (Animals) |
| Phylum same | Chordata (Chordates) | Chordata (Chordates) |
| Class | Amphibia (Amphibians) | Mammalia (Mammals) |
| Order | Anura (Frogs & Toads) | Rodentia (Rodents) |
| Family | Arthroleptidae | Muridae (Mice & Rats) |
| Genus | Arthroleptis | Gerbillus |
| Species | Arthroleptis xenodactylus | Gerbillus gerbillus |
Evolutionary Relationship
Eastern Squeaker and Lesser Egyptian Gerbil share a common ancestor at the Phylum level: Chordata. (Chordates)
